A New Office In North CarolinaThis year, Sizemore Group celebrates 45 years of creating culturally-significant spaces and planning beautiful, inspiring places. As we reach this milestone, Sizemore Group will open an office in the greater Asheville area to continue serving clients throughout the Southeast.
Tom Sayre, who has been with Sizemore Group for 40 years, has moved to Sylva, NC, to open the firm’s new location in a heavy timber office. Tom is a leading voice in sustainable design practice with significant expertise in schools and libraries. His passion drives the integration of sustainable design across all market sectors, particularly those leading North Carolina’s economy.

Higher education and sustainability are hallmarks of the western North Carolina region, making it a strategic fit for Sizemore Group.

The state ranks one of the highest in the nation for green building certification and is home to nearly 200 colleges or trade schools. Sizemore Group’s rich history working with schools, colleges and universities has taught us that renovating existing structures may yield higher, more comprehensive returns than starting from scratch.

Asheville is known for its signature adapted and reused architecture. The city’s popular downtown is filled with vibrant new businesses within repurposed old buildings. Sizemore Group emphasizes breathing new life into abandoned and forgotten buildings, turning them into beautiful, functional spaces that strengthen communities and economies.
